There are three main software packages for Bluetooth:
1. Microsoft (the one you don't like)
2. Broadcom
3. Toshiba
I don't know if the Toshiba one has been updated for Vista. Broacom's has. Neither of these is available for purchase, though. You're at the mercy of your notebook manufacturer or the manufacturer of your bluetooth adapter. With the exception of Toshiba, which uses their own software, most vendors choose to include the Broadcom software. You'll need to go to your manufacturer's site to see if they are offering the Vista version of the software, though. Unfortunately, the software does a security check when it starts and if the device in your notebook isn't the device that the driver you downloaded is for (same manufacturer and model), it won't work.
